Description:
Pacman cannot install texlive-htmlxml accusing corruption. I tried few repositories so far, I believe there's a problem with the database entry, or something, as long as the package was last updated in May, while the error is recent.

Additional info:
* package version: 2008.12803-1
* Error output:

checking package integrity...
:: File texlive-htmlxml-2008.12803-1-x86_64.pkg.tar.gz is corrupted. Do you want to delete it? [Y/n]
error: failed to commit transaction (invalid or corrupted package)
texlive-htmlxml-2008.12803-1-x86_64.pkg.tar.gz is invalid or corrupted
Errors occurred, no packages were upgraded.


Steps to reproduce:

# pacman -Syw texlive-htmlxml
